Output 75d3131bf2983f77d78c7017fa4487793578d4d551d369b7522a0db0c0de6393:1

value
10634059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49a3bb20636bb894c4b63f5f5d195cf3c73f9d7b OP_EQUAL
address
38QPPmrPdjmfyjQgp1hhP6wH6kV6mJXgSB
transaction
75d3131bf2983f77d78c7017fa4487793578d4d551d369b7522a0db0c0de6393
spent
true